Understanding the Power of TikTok

 

With over a billion active users, TikTok is a cultural phenomenon that shapes music trends and discovery. Evidently, songs that go viral on TikTok often see a surge in streams and downloads across other platforms.

 

That’s why, leveraging this platform can be a game-changer for artists looking to expand their reach.

 

Anyway, to get started on this, here are steps to follow:

 

1. Create Engaging Content

 

The foundation of successful promotion on TikTok is engaging content, hence, you should focus on these to achieve results:

 

Identify Your Hook: Choose a catchy part of your song that can serve as the hook. This should be memorable and easily shareable, encouraging users to create their own videos using your track.

 

Utilize Trends: Participate in trending challenges or create your own that incorporates your music. This encourages user interaction and helps your song gain traction within the TikTok community.

 

2. Collaborate with Influencers

 

Partnering with influencers can amplify your reach on TikTok, moreover, to do this, you should:

 

Choose Relevant Influencers: Identify influencers whose audience aligns with your target demographic. Collaborating with them can introduce your music to new listeners.

 

Creative Integration: Work with influencers to create unique content that features your music organically, whether through dance challenges, lip-syncs, or storytelling.

 

3. Use Hashtags Strategically

 

Hashtags are essential for increasing the discoverability of your content, so you should properly endeavor to:

 

Research Popular Hashtags: Use trending hashtags related to music and challenges to enhance visibility.

 

Create a Unique Hashtag: Develop a branded hashtag for your song that fans can use when creating their content. This helps build a community around your music.

 

4. Engage with Your Audience

 

Building a relationship with your audience is crucial for long-term success, nevertheless, here are a few tips to get started:

 

Respond to Comments: Engage with users who comment on your videos or use your music in their content. This interaction fosters community and encourages further engagement.

 

Host Live Sessions: Utilize TikTok Live to connect with fans in real-time, answer questions, and share behind-the-scenes insights about your music.

 

5. Tease Your Releases

 

Generate excitement leading up to your music release, surely, this can be done by:

 

Posting Snippets: Share short clips or teasers of your upcoming song to build anticipation among followers.

 

Countdowns: Use countdowns or themed posts leading up to the release date to keep followers engaged and excited about the launch.

 

6. Run Targeted Ads

 

Consider using TikTok’s advertising features for broader reach:

 

In-Feed Ads: Create engaging ads that appear in users’ feeds, also, it should showcase snippets of your song or exciting visuals.

 

Branded Hashtag Challenges: Launch a branded challenge that encourages user participation while promoting your track. This can lead to organic growth as users create content around your music.
